Illinois Institute of Technology is Hiring a Research Business Specialist Near Chicago, IL

The mission of the Research Administration Services Department ( RAS ) is to provide administrative service to principal investigators and University administration in the area of post-award management. The Research Business Specialist will manage a faculty portfolio of varying complexity, aid in interpreting terms and conditions, and regulations, provide guidance to faculty concerning grant compliance matters, provide advanced oversight of financial grant expenditure, communicate proactive financial advice and planning and resolve complicated issues related to post award matters.
You will thrive in this position if you are customer service minded, enjoy working in teams, value collaboration, have technical savvy for sponsored award finance data, are an excellent communicator and have high ethical standards. You must have a strong ability to write well and communicate at a professional level. You also must be able to embrace and participate in change processes, and be dedicated to continual learning and improvement.

Key Responsibilities
Key Responsibility
Manages day to day monitoring of portfolio-based grants and contracts of varying complexity related to post-award activities throughout the life of the award. Provides guidance to principal investigators in Banner financial processes, and Cognos reports. Helps faculty interpret complex grant and contract agreements.
Percentage Of Time
40
Key Responsibility
Forecasts and planning for PIs award spending. Review grants for deficits/overspending, budget revisions, carry forward requests, requisitions, vendor payments, salary reallocation, closeouts, and ensuring effort reporting is correct and certified on a timely basis. Provide assistance and training to PIs to ensure that costs and expenses meeting Uniform Guidance requirements.
Proactively evaluates and resolves problems and makes decisions. Serves as a liaison between PIs, other campus offices for grant and financial issues (i.e., Sponsored Research and Programs, Grant and Contract Accounting and others).
Percentage Of Time
40
Key Responsibility
Preparation of documents to correct transaction problems on grants in relation to ongoing review of expenditures (i.e., payroll and tuition, etc.). Considerable communication and relationship-building with department financial contacts (i.e., coordinator, budget manager) is required to be successful in this key responsibility.
Percentage Of Time
20
Key Responsibility
Responsible oversight and process for all the effort reporting across campus. Requires ongoing meetings with Principal Investigators to ensure that the university is compliant with effort reporting.
Percentage Of Time
15
